Household of Cornelis Gerrits Laffra

He is married to Marijke Arjens van Helder.

They got married on June 3, 1804 at Sloten, Friesland, Nederland, he was 30 years old.

Wedding Registry Wyckel Reformed Church 1772-1810

Child(ren):

  1. NN Laffra  1806-????
  2. Gerrit Kornelis Laffra  1811-1845 
  3. Femke Cornelis Laffra  1813-1888 
  4. Stillborn Laffra  1820-1820
  5. Wybe Laffra  1821-1911 
  6. NN Laffra  ????-1806

  11. Geni World Family Tree, via https://www.myheritage.com/research/reco...
    Cornelis Marinus Laffra
    Gender: Male
    Birth: Sep 3 1773 - The Hague, The Hague, South Holland, Netherlands
    Death: Feb 3 1847 - Sloten, Gaasterlân-Sleat, Friesland, Netherlands
    Father: Gerrit Alberts Laffra
    Mother: Geertruijd Laffra (born Kappelhoff)
    Wife: Marijke Arries Arjens Laffra (born van Helderen (Helder)
    Child: <a>Gerrit Kornelis Laffra
